Victor Arley Agudelo Monsalve, now 29, accepted a plea deal in Mecklenburg County court on Thursday, pleading guilty to second-degree murder. He was originally charged with first-degree murder in the death of Yamile Alejandra Giraldo Gomez, but agreed to the lesser charge.
According to Charlotte-Mecklenburg Police, the deadly stabbing happened on December 23, 2023, at a home on Hermsley Road in the Steele Creek area. CMPD officers responded to a domestic violence call and found Gomez with severe stab wounds.
Tragically, she was pronounced dead at the scene. Agudelo Monsalve was arrested nearby after the attack. Following an investigation, he was taken into custody and charged with murder.
As part of the plea deal, Agudelo Monsalve was sentenced to between 20 to 25 years in prison. He will serve his sentence in the North Carolina Department of Adult Corrections. He received credit for 593 days already spent in jail while awaiting trial, court records state.
The court also ordered him to pay over $5,800 in restitution and court fees.
